Most biogas software tools trigger threshold alarms once equipment is already faulting, drifting away from revenue, feedstock, & CI goals.
Anessa's software tool models VFA dynamics, FOS/TAC ratio, ammonia inhibition, and gas composition drift and flags problems 24–72 hours earlier, while there's still time to act and keep production up to par.

Key Capabilities
Five things we monitor for you
-
A live, visual Process Flow Diagram of the plant that shows equipment status, flow directions, and key metrics such as temperature, pressure, and volume, viewable across minute, hour, or day timeframes.
-
Ensures trusted and verifiable results by automated checks that catch frozen, drifting, or missing sensor data before it becomes a real problem.
-
Replace paper logs and spreadsheets with digital round forms — operators log visual inspections, foam presence, and manual readings directly into the same system as the sensor data.
-
Alerts triggered by cross-referenced conditions (like a lagoon overflow risk combining storage level, capacity, and rainfall forecast) flag issues before they become costly incidents, not after.
-
Track equipment downtime, tie it back to the root cause, and get maintenance-trigger alerts generated from combined process indicators before a small issue becomes an expensive outage.
